package com.linkedin.pinot.core.plan;
import com.linkedin.pinot.core.common.Operator;
import java.util.ArrayList;
import java.util.List;
import java.util.concurrent.ExecutorService;
import java.util.concurrent.Executors;
import junit.framework.Assert;
import org.testng.annotations.Test;
public class CombinePlanNodeTest {
private ExecutorService _executorService = Executors.newFixedThreadPool(10);
@Test
public void testSlowPlanNode() {
// Warning: this test is slow (take 10 seconds).
List<PlanNode> planNodes = new ArrayList<>();
for (int i = 0; i < 20; i++) {
planNodes.add(new PlanNode() {
@Override
public Operator run() {
try {
Thread.sleep(20000);
} catch (InterruptedException e) {
// Ignored.
}
return null;
}
@Override
public void showTree(String prefix) {
}
});
}
CombinePlanNode combinePlanNode = new CombinePlanNode(planNodes, null, _executorService, 0);
try {
combinePlanNode.run();
} catch (RuntimeException e) {
Assert.assertEquals(e.getCause().toString(), "java.util.concurrent.TimeoutException");
return;
}
// Fail.
Assert.fail();
}
@Test
public void testPlanNodeThrowException() {
List<PlanNode> planNodes = new ArrayList<>();
for (int i = 0; i < 20; i++) {
planNodes.add(new PlanNode() {
@Override
public Operator run() {
throw new RuntimeException("Inner exception message.");
}
@Override
public void showTree(String prefix) {
}
});
}
CombinePlanNode combinePlanNode = new CombinePlanNode(planNodes, null, _executorService, 0);
try {
combinePlanNode.run();
} catch (RuntimeException e) {
Assert.assertEquals(e.getCause().getMessage(), "java.lang.RuntimeException: Inner exception message.");
return;
}
// Fail.
Assert.fail();
}
}
